Indonesian hardliners seek to ban Rotary, Lions clubs: reports
AFP ^ | 02/01/09 | Staff

Posted on 02/02/2009 11:45:05 AM PST by forkinsocket

JAKARTA (AFP) — Indonesian Islamic hardliners have called for a ban on international organisations the Rotary Club and the Lions Club, saying they are part of a Zionist conspiracy, reports said Monday.

The (FUU) said the clubs were "infidel" fronts for Freemasonry and the world Zionist movement and threatened Islam in the world's most populous Muslim country.

"They gather funds and give them to America and the Israeli Zionists," FUU chairman Atian Ali Mohammad Da'i was quoted as saying in The Jakarta Globe daily.

"We urge all Muslims to renounce membership in the Rotary Club and the Lions Club. Otherwise they can consider themselves infidels."

He called on President Susilo Bambang Yudhoyono to ban the groups.
